Re: Retirement of the Stonebriar product line

Stonebriar sales have declined for five consecutive quarters and support costs now exceed contribution margin. The retirement plan is staged: new orders close end of Q2, existing contracts honoured through their terms, and spares stocked for twenty-four months. Sales leads should steer prospects toward the Ashgrove range; migration incentives are already approved. Customer comms are drafted and awaiting legal sign-off. The forward strategy behind this decision is set out in the note below.

confidential, yafog-hagug: Gross margin on Druix came in at 10 percent against a plan of 15 percent. Only 5 of the 80 pilot accounts renewed Druix, so a churn review is set for October 1.

Regional Sales Review — Q3 Summary

The Veldmark region closed the quarter at 4% above plan, driven by steady reorders from the Harlow Basin accounts. Coastal territories lagged, with the Pellingford branch missing target by 6% on delayed fixture installations. Discounting remained within policy across all districts. Marnie Okafor's team flagged rising freight costs as the main margin pressure heading into Q4, and a corrective pricing review is scheduled. Finance should note one item before circulating this summary further.

management briefing: The pricing group signed off on a budget of $378.8 million for Project Kasael.

## 3.4.0 — Changed defaults

Timetabler Prisma now defaults to room-capacity-strict mode and a 90-second solve timeout (was unlimited). Schools on the Larkfield plan will see faster but occasionally partial solutions; advise them to raise the timeout if needed. Double-booking warnings are now errors. The new default configuration shipped with this release is as follows.

settings of yahag-yafog:
[pramir]
host = pramir.qirvancorp.internal
user = pramir_svc
database = pramir_prod

**Q: The stringharvest extraction script locked me out again — what now?**

Yep, this keeps coming up at the weekly sync, so here's the deal. The stringharvest script that pulls translation strings out of the Mossbeck app templates uses a signed cache, and if your local clock drifts, it invalidates your operator token. Don't delete the cache folder — that makes it worse. Just run the script with the --recover flag and wait for the prompt. When it asks for verification, type the passphrase shown right below.

recovery phrase for fajeg-hagug: holox-fenmir